This Song Will Help You Get Through Losing A Loved One & Bring Peace To Your Soul

The video of Guy Penrod and Sarah Darling singing “What I Know About Heaven” opens with a soothing piano melody. The calm in their voices and the lyrics creates a reassuring tone.

Guy Penrod’s rich voice begins the song, soon joined by Sarah Darling’s harmonies that are nothing short of “angelic.” The song paints a serene picture of Heaven as a place where “streets are paved with gold for each broken heart and each wounded soul.”

Grieving the loss of a loved one can leave an overwhelming void. This emotional ballad offers solace, helping listeners navigate their pain. It reminds us that our loved ones are now in a place of peace and love.

“There is no need to be ashamed of your feelings,” the song reassures. Tears may come, but they will also bring joy as the lyrics vividly describe a heavenly reunion filled with everlasting life and love.

The live performance captures the connection between the musicians and their audience. The lyrics pose a poignant question: “Why would I want to call one away from that?” reminding us of the beauty awaiting our loved ones.
